Sentence examples of "ocurrirá" in Spanish

<>
Tom está esperando ver qué ocurrirá. Tom is waiting to see what will happen.
Pero, desgraciadamente, esto no ocurrirá pronto. But unfortunately, this will not occur very soon.
No sé qué ocurrirá a partir de ahora. You never can tell what is going to happen.
De acuerdo con los datos del problema, ¿podemos afirmar que ocurrirá reflexión o refracción? According to the data in this problem, can we affirm that reflection or refraction is going to occur?
